What is the active chemical in Rauwolfia vomitoria?
Reserpine is an active chemical extracted from Rauwolfia vomitoria. It also is used to treat severe agitation in patients with mental disorders. Reserpine is in a class of medications called rauwolfia alkaloids. It works by slowing the activity of the nervous system, causing the heart rate to slow and the blood vessels to dilate 9,12.
What is the difference between Rauwolfia serpentina and Rauwolfia vomitoria?
Rauwolfia serpentina (Indian Snake Root) is an endangered species and illegal to import. Rauwolfia vomitoria (African Snake Root) is widely available and not endangered.
